Video shows teenager driving stolen car before running over two women and being apprehended
A teenager in Teresina, Brazil, was apprehended after running over two women while driving a stolen car, having recorded a bragging video moments before the incident.
In Teresina, Brazil, a teenager recorded a video bragging about driving a car he allegedly stole, just moments before he ran over two women and was subsequently apprehended by the police. The incident occurred on Thursday afternoon, sparking significant attention from law enforcement and local media. The authorities have blurred the identities of the teenager and his accomplices in adherence to child protection laws in Brazil, as they are all minors.
The video circulating online shows the adolescent boasting about the stolen vehicle, and he is seen engaging in specific hand gestures with an accomplice that the police are investigating for potential links to a criminal gang. Additionally, he filmed another teenager driving a different stolen car shortly before the collision occurred, indicating a possible pattern of theft and reckless behavior among the youths involved.
Police officials have confirmed that two women were injured in the incident and that investigations are underway to determine the full extent of the criminal activities tied to this group of minors. The Department of Vehicle Theft and Robbery is actively pursuing additional leads to ensure accountability and prevent further incidents involving juvenile offenders in the region.
